Sometimes I send my email by gmail,but it fails to send my attachment.I
think I click the "send" too early.
Can you tell me at what time should I click the "send" after I have
attached a file in gmail?

you click attach, then browse, select the file > but now it isn't uploaded.
when you clock send it starts uploading, now you should wait.
sometimes gmail tries to autosave message>then the attachment is
uploading, while you write message.

just wait after clicking SEND, how much you must wait depends on size
of the attachment AND your internet upload speed.
if it fails>maybe your internet connectivity has shutted down for few
seconds or the size of the message (text+attachments) is bigger than
10MB. or you are trying to send executable files.

Whenever I attach anything I "save now" before I send and wait until the attachments show up as links instead of bold black text (IE) or browse boxes (Firefox). Then I send because I know the attachments have been uploaded to the server already.
